Descriptor time format
This commit is contained in:
@ -321,7 +321,7 @@ public partial class ProcessData : IProcessData
|
||||
string defaultLayer = string.Empty;
|
||||
string defaultReactor = string.Empty;
|
||||
string defaultEmployee = string.Empty;
|
||||
if (Regex.IsMatch(text, @"^[a-zA-z][0-9]{4}$"))
|
||||
if (Regex.IsMatch(text, @"^[a-zA-z][0-9]{2,4}$"))
|
||||
{
|
||||
cassette = text.ToUpper();
|
||||
psn = defaultPSN;
|
||||
@ -423,7 +423,6 @@ public partial class ProcessData : IProcessData
|
||||
if (dateTimeText.EndsWith("."))
|
||||
dateTimeText = dateTimeText.Remove(dateTimeText.Length - 1, 1);
|
||||
date = GetDateTime(logistics, dateTimeText);
|
||||
;
|
||||
Descriptor descriptor = GetDescriptor(text);
|
||||
cassette = descriptor.Cassette;
|
||||
psn = descriptor.PSN;
|
||||
@ -457,9 +456,13 @@ public partial class ProcessData : IProcessData
|
||||
receivedData = File.ReadAllText(logistics.ReportFullPath);
|
||||
_Log.Debug($"****ParseData - Source file contents:");
|
||||
_Log.Debug(receivedData);
|
||||
string[] files = Directory.GetFiles(Path.GetDirectoryName(logistics.ReportFullPath), string.Concat(originalDataBioRad, logistics.Sequence, "*"), SearchOption.TopDirectoryOnly);
|
||||
foreach (string file in files)
|
||||
fileInfoCollection.Add(new FileInfo(file));
|
||||
List<string> moveFiles = new();
|
||||
string directoryName = Path.GetDirectoryName(logistics.ReportFullPath);
|
||||
string fileNameWithoutExtension = Path.GetFileNameWithoutExtension(logistics.ReportFullPath);
|
||||
moveFiles.AddRange(Directory.GetFiles(directoryName, string.Concat(originalDataBioRad, "*", logistics.Sequence, "*"), SearchOption.TopDirectoryOnly));
|
||||
moveFiles.AddRange(Directory.GetFiles(directoryName, string.Concat(originalDataBioRad, "*", fileNameWithoutExtension.Split('_').Last(), "*"), SearchOption.TopDirectoryOnly));
|
||||
foreach (string moveFile in moveFiles.Distinct())
|
||||
fileInfoCollection.Add(new FileInfo(moveFile));
|
||||
if (!string.IsNullOrEmpty(receivedData))
|
||||
{
|
||||
int i;
|
||||
|
Reference in New Issue
Block a user